As a Principal Quantitative Pharmacologist in Pharmacometrics (PMx), this individual is encouraged to provide contributions to PMx results in support of programs. This role also prospectively provides PMx contributions in support of longer-term development strategies implemented over the course of multiple experiments, studies, and/or clinical trials. The individual will prospectively design and conduct quantitative or other PMx analyses of a sophisticated nature or otherwise appropriate that is consistent with and encouraging of the program development strategy for one or more programs. They will keep PMx management advised of significant PMx results and act as a PMx Program Representative on program teams, efficiently communicating sophisticated PMx results in colloquial terms that are understandable across the development teams. This role implements PMx management strategic or otherwise impactful changes to the program strategy, direction, and/or regulatory interactions. As a PMx Program Representative, with limited mentorship from PMx management, they will be responsible for authoring PMx contributions to regulatory documentation, such as IB’s, as well as briefing documents for pre-IND, EOP2, and other global Health Authority (HA) meetings. They will be responsible for the preparation and timely delivery of accurate and well-articulated study reports as well as regulatory submission documents as appropriate. This role also contributes accurate tables and figures for inclusion in slides for senior management presentations and is able to independently draft and review documentation for accuracy, clarity and messaging to ensure documents are appropriate for further PMx management review. Additional analyses will be performed as required to support regulatory interactions. The role involves sharing scientific ideas and contributing to the mentoring of PMx staff. With some supervision, the individual will competently represent PMx at pre-IND, Type C, pre-BLA, and other HA meetings.
